Die Propper® Dual-Compliant Wildland Station Pant ist als typische Wildland-„Buschhose“ konstruiert und speziell dafür konzipiert, auch strenge Standards für Stationskleidung zu erfüllen. Wenn die Waldbrände aus dem Wald ziehen, sind Sie bereit zu kämpfen.

INTELLIGENTES DESIGN: Die Hose hat extra tiefe Eingrifftaschen vorne und einen selbstsichernden Nomex-Reißverschluss mit Knopf und interner Sturmklappe. Maschinenwaschbar, ohne dass die grüne Farbe verblasst, da die Farbechtheit mehreren industriellen Wäschen standhält. HOHE STRAPAZIERFÄHIGKEIT: Feuerwehrhosen zeichnen sich durch hervorragende Strapazierfähigkeit, Abrieb- und Reißfestigkeit, Falten an den Knien und robuste Riegelverstärkung in allen beanspruchten Bereichen aus. FEUCHTIGKEITSABWEISEND: Die feuerhemmende Hose bietet dank der firmeneigenen Schnelltrocknungstechnologie, die Feuchtigkeit verteilt und so für eine bessere Verdunstung sorgt, ein hervorragendes Feuchtigkeitsmanagement. SICHERHEITSZERTIFIZIERT: Die Cargohose besteht aus Spezialstoffen, die für optimale Leistung ausgewählt wurden. Die Salbeifarbe verwendet Westex Synergy, hergestellt aus 100 % Nomex IIIA. Die Farbe Station Navy verwendet Synergy Pro, die nächste Weiterentwicklung von Aramid von Westex und bietet weichen Komfort. FEUERBESTÄNDIGE HOSE: Diese taktische Hose für Männer bietet feuerfesten Schutz und Sichtbarkeit in Kombination. Wird von Wildland-Feuerwehrleuten zum Schutz vor Hitze und Stichfeuer getragen. Maschinenwäsche. Reißverschluss. Importiert. 93 % Nomex, 5 % Kevlar, 2 % antistatisch.

Scritto da: Jhai
Runs big and baggy, size down
I first ordered the mediums but they were very baggy. Then I ordered the small and they fit pretty good with enough room and length.
Scritto da: jeremy ramirez
Runs big, as others have said
The sizes are pretty far off, I typically would wear a size large, but in these I'm wearing a small?!? Haha, I ordered large, then medium, then small.. small somewhat fits, I tried extra small and the waste was just a little bit too tight, length and bagginess was good but waist too tight so I decided to stick with the size small I had ordered before (I still had them waiting to see how the x small fit). To give reference, I am 5'11, I weigh 175 lbs, I typically wear a size 33 waist in jeans. The small in these is actually still a little big (more like a 34 waist?) But they work since you can tighten the sides of them with the built in buckles and also we will be wearing a belt with these pants in the wildland setting anyway, also if worn in cold weather with thermals it will take up a little space as well. Good luck hope this helped.
